WEBER COUNTY -- Motorists in Weber County had quite a mess to deal with Saturday afternoon. A semi truck loaded with onions overturned, and the onions went everywhere.
Utah Highway Patrol troopers said the truck was heading south on Interstate 15. When the driver exited to get on eastbound Interstate 84, the trailer tipped over, scattering the onions in the right lane.
The accident happened on an overpass, and some of the onions fell to the street below. One vehicle was hit, causing minor damage.
The truck was hauling onions from Oregon to North Carolina.
